Imphal: President Droupadi Murmu, who is now on a two-day visit to Manipur, on Friday paid floral tributes at the Nupi Lal Memorial complex in Imphal on the occasion of the 86th Nupi Lal Day, which commemorates two women-led movements against the British policies.

The President also offered prayers at the Shree Govindaji temple at Palace Compound, located around two km from the Nupi Lal Memorial complex.

An official said that President Murmu offered floral tributes at the Nupi Lal Memorial Complex, paying heartfelt homage to the brave women warriors of Manipur whose courage continues to inspire generations. Governor Ajay Kumar Bhalla, who accompanied the President, also paid floral tributes at the memorial.
